Understanding the Core Gameplay of Chicken Road
At its heart, Chicken Road is a remarkably straightforward game. The objective is simple: predict when the round will end and cash out before the chicken is unable to cross the road. A multiplier increases with each passing moment, representing the potential payout. The longer you wait, the higher the multiplier, but also the greater the risk. The round ends randomly, meaning there’s no pattern to predict. A successful withdrawal before the crash secures your winnings, proportional to the multiplier at the time of cash out.
The visual representation of the game adds to the excitement. An animated chicken attempts to cross a busy road, and the multiplier climbs as it progresses. The impending crash is signaled by various cues, such as the chicken slowing down or encountering an obstacle. Experienced players often rely on these visual cues, along with their instinct, to determine the optimal moment to withdraw.
Many platforms offer features like auto-cash out, allowing players to set a desired multiplier and automatically withdraw their bet when it’s reached. This is a useful tool for managing risk and ensuring consistent profit. However, relying solely on auto-cash out can also limit potential earnings, as it may prevent you from capitalizing on exceptionally high multipliers.

The Psychological Aspects of Playing Chicken Road
The adrenaline-pumping nature of Chicken Road can easily lead to impulsive decisions. It’s important to maintain a level head and avoid chasing losses. Emotional bets are often detrimental, as they cloud judgment and increase the likelihood of misjudging when to cash out. Disciplined bankroll management and adherence to a pre-defined strategy are essential.
The fast-paced nature of the game can also be addictive, prompting players to increase their bet sizes or play for extended periods. Setting time limits and taking regular breaks are crucial for maintaining control and preventing unhealthy gambling habits. Remember, Chicken Road, like all casino games, should be viewed as a form of entertainment, and not a source of income.
Many platforms attempting to help mitigate this have started providing built-in statistical data about a player’s choices over time. For example providing a chart of how a player has cashed out over dozens of rounds can help identify subconscious patterns that could be detrimental to long-term success.
